## ✨ ABOUT THIS EVENT

Join us for a refined and intimate self-guided visit to The Frick Collection, one of New York City’s most elegant and beloved museums — a perfect way to begin the new year. Housed in the former Gilded Age mansion of industrialist Henry Clay Frick, the museum offers an extraordinary setting in which masterworks of European painting, sculpture, and decorative arts are displayed within historic rooms rather than traditional gallery spaces. Every visit feels like stepping into another time. ## 🖌️ EXHIBITIONS WE WILL SEE

In addition to the permanent collection, we will focus on two exceptional special exhibitions:

### ✨ To the Holy Sepulcher: Treasures from the Terra Sancta Museum

This remarkable exhibition presents sacred artworks and devotional objects from the Terra Sancta Museum, many of which are rarely seen outside the Holy Land. The works trace centuries of pilgrimage, faith, craftsmanship, and cultural exchange — offering a powerful, moving experience set within The Frick’s serene galleries.

### 🌸 Flora Yukhnovich: Four Seasons

This contemporary exhibition places Yukhnovich’s vibrant, expressive paintings into dialogue with the historic surroundings of The Frick.
Her work reimagines themes from Rococo painting with bold color, movement, and emotional intensity — creating a fascinating contrast between old and new, tradition and reinvention.
